Being a ROCK is more than just saying NO, it’s choosing to say YES to things that lead people AND OURSELVES to a place that brings an eternal life change.
We are all leading someone, somewhere…. to me it’s black and white — we are either leading people to the things of God or we are leading them to the things of hell. There is no in between. so ask yourself…
- What is your life exemplifying?
EXAMPLE by definition is: a pattern, in morals or manners; a copy, or model; that which is proposed or is proper to be imitated.
- How are you being an influence on those around you?
INFLUENCE by definition is: the capacity to have an effect on the character, development, or behavior of someone or something.
- Are you “being a rock” when it comes to how you live your life in front of others?
ROCK by definition is: used in similes and metaphors to refer to someone or something that is extremely strong and reliable.
Practically speaking, the following are just a few things to have set up in your life to help you succeed in standing firm! …..
- Have your mind made up on where you stand and what you stand for… THOUGHTS BECOME ACTIONS. ACTIONS BECOME HABITS. HABITS BECOME LIFESTYLES.
- Have someone in your life that loves you enough to not let you stay in YOUR mess (mentor, peer, friend, etc.)
- Actually live out what you say you believe. In other words, make sure your actions line up with what you say your values are. DON’T BE CONFUSING!
- Hope and dream for yourself! You can do it!
- More than all of that, find yourself in an unashamed friendship with your Maker. It’s the only thing that will sustain!
